Quick Pantry Staple Caramel Sauce

Source: donuts2crumpets
Quick and easy creamy caramel sauce is made from pantry staples so you can make it to drizzle it over ice cream or desserts whenever you like!
Servings: 16
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 7 minutes
5 from 3 votes

Ingredients
  

  • 3/4 cup butter, (NOT margarine)
  • 1-1/2 cups firmly packed brown sugar
  • 1-1/2 Tbsp water
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 3/4 cup evaporated milk
  • 1 Tbsp vanilla extract

Instructions
 

  • Place butter, brown sugar, water, and salt in a medium sauce pan, then place the saucepan over medium heat, stirring gently with a wooden spoon until the butter melts.
  • Let the mixture come to a boil then let simmer for 5-7 minutes, stirring every now and then. It will be super bubbly!
  • Remove the saucepan from the heat and drizzle in the evaporated milk and vanilla while continuing to stir. (I mix the two ingredients together first, then add them in.)
  • Let the mixture cool to room temperature. It will thicken as it cools!
